HARDY FLEX: evidence, calculation and a steel control
The comparison keeps the exterior geometry and load concept constant and changes only the shell material. This makes the difference in damage geometry and thermal behaviour clear and directly comparable.
Basis: ρplywood ≈ 700 kg/m³; ρsteel = 7,850 kg/m³; plywood E = 7.452–10.048 GPa; steel E = 210 GPa; λplywood = 0.147–0.175 W/(m·K); λsteel = 48 W/(m·K). E·t³ is a panel screening index only. Complete-body response depends on ribs, joints, openings, supports, speed, mass, contact geometry and duration.
How damage starts and propagates
For FLEX, preservation of the two-section and joint geometry matters as much as the shell. A real run into a concrete wall showed local abrasion and a small edge chip without visible loss of body geometry.


Concrete-wall collision after a 30 m full-command run
The photographs record the actual post-event condition: local abrasion and a small edge chip without visible loss of body geometry. The side panel and bumper attachment remained intact. Impact energy was not instrumented during this run.


The event ends; the inspection begins
Impulse response is assessed separately for the front section, articulation and rear module. Joint clearance, drive mounts and free relative movement are checked after the event.

What happens as the load increases
Plywood does not make the vehicle indestructible. Its practical value is that damage can remain visible, local and repairable before the load reaches critical joints or internal equipment.
Surface trace
Raptor-coating abrasion, scratches and a shallow edge mark. Geometry and function remain unchanged.
Local crushing
Veneer compression, a small layered chip or short delamination near the contact or fastener. Inspection and a local repair are required.
Joint displacement
A joint can open, an angle connector can deform, or a fastener can pull through. Alignment, drive mounts and retained equipment must be checked.
Functional failure
At higher energy the panel or rib can fracture, equipment can shift and mobility can be lost. The damaged module must be replaced; no protection claim is implied.
The transition points depend on mass, actual speed, angle and area of contact, support conditions, moisture, manufacturing quality and the final configuration. They must be established by instrumented tests for each model.
STRUCTURAL ARCHITECTURE
A plywood monocoque, not decorative cladding
The current HARDY body is a load-sharing plywood box with plywood stiffening ribs, 3 mm steel angle connectors, industrial bearings and local metal interfaces. Its performance comes from the closed geometry, rib spacing, joints and quality control — not from a claim that plywood is equivalent to armour steel.
